The Space vs Output Dilemma

Imagine trying to power a 2,500 sq.ft home with 2019-era panels. You'd need 28 modules versus just 22 with 450W units – saving 65 sq.ft of precious roof real estate. Recent data from SolarTech Analytics shows:

  • 22% faster installation times with high-wattage panels
  • $0.12/watt lower balance-of-system costs
  • 17% reduction in racking materials

Breaking Down 450W Panel Economics

Wait, no – it's not just about upfront costs. Let's crunch numbers from an actual Arizona installation:

System Size 9.9kW (22 panels)
Annual Output 16,200kWh
Payback Period 6.8 years

Compare this to older 375W systems needing 27 panels for similar output. The 450W setup saves $1,900 in labor and racking alone. Not too shabby, right?

Battery Synergy You Can't Ignore

Here's where it gets juicy. Modern 450W panels pair perfectly with 5kW+ battery systems. Take California's NEM 3.0 regulations – they've basically made solar-storage combos mandatory for decent ROI. With higher-wattage panels:

  1. You charge batteries 23% faster during peak sun
  2. Need fewer optimizers/microinverters
  3. Maintain backup power longer during outages

Installation Realities in 2023

But hold on – are these panels right for everyone? Roofs with complex angles might not benefit as much. A recent Colorado case study showed:

"South-facing 450W arrays outperformed east-west setups by 31% in winter months. Proper orientation remains critical despite higher wattage."

Still, manufacturers are pushing boundaries. Trina Solar's new Vertex S+ series claims 22.8% efficiency – up from 21% in 2021 models. They're using something called non-destructive cutting tech to minimize cell fractures. Fancy stuff!

Myth-Busting High-Wattage Panels

"Aren't they too heavy?" Actually, modern 450W modules weigh just 2.3lbs/sq.ft – same as 2018's 300W panels. Thanks to back-contact cell designs and slimmer frames, they're easier to handle than you'd think.

Another common concern: "Do they overheat faster?" Well...temperature coefficients have improved dramatically. SunPower's M-Series maintains 94% output at 113°F versus 88% in older models. Proper ventilation still matters, but it's less of a deal-breaker now.
